Large sedans in Russia it is, first of all, Toyota Camry and Volkswagen Passat. Sales volumes of Korean or French cars are minimal, and premium sedans are left out of the test. Still, only these cars can boast of more or less serious figures in the sales volume graphs.

Globally Volkswagen concerns and Toyota are bitter competitors. From year to year, both companies beat sales records, pulling the title of the largest in the world from each other, but in the local confrontation of two specific brands on Russian market is driven by Toyota. And this is largely due to the success of the localized four-door Camry, which has been holding the title of the most popular business sedan on the Russian market for many years in a row. The secret of success is simple and simple: the reputation of a reliable car, customer loyalty to the brand and, most importantly, a very attractive price tag, thanks to which the model has long become a familiar attribute of an average civil servant and a fully formed private trader.

Almost the same could be said about the Volkswagen Passat, but one would have to make an adjustment for the price and, as a result, sales volumes. We have loved the Passat for generations, starting with the famous B3 of the late 1980s. A reference car by the standards of the middle class, the car has always been prevented from becoming an absolute bestseller only by the higher price tag compared to the Japanese, but also on the streets and in corporate garages, Passat has always been known as a very worthy car. It is a pity that the current eighth entered the market at such an unfortunate time, when the euro rate skyrocketed, the organization local build turned out to be meaningless, and the credibility of the brand was noticeably crippled by the diesel scandal. However, it doesn't smell like a failure - the Russian price tag is no worse than that of competitors from Korea, and with careful handling of the configurator, the new Passat may well compete even with the Camry. The only question is what exactly he will be able to offer for this money in a segment where all the options seem to be scheduled by the Japanese for years to come.

We are used to considering the Passat an overgrown European class "D", and Camry has always been recorded in the "E" segment, and visually, the Japanese sedan seems larger. But the concept of a mid-size sedan has long been blurred, and in terms of numbers, the Passat of the eighth generation even slightly surpasses the Camry in both length and wheelbase. Even the Camry's huge stern contains less than the reported VDA-liters in the luggage compartment. The Passat hides its volume under the elegant body lines, framed by discreet chrome and chiseled LED optics. There is a charisma in these almost straight designer strokes that the model, perhaps, has not yet had. Volkswagen cars can be considered boring, but the eighth generation sedan is spectacular. The strict lines make the look solid, and the stern frowning face hints that the owner is not up to jokes. Probably, this is how the new Phaeton should have looked, but so far it is the Passat that is visually perceived as the most representative car of the brand.

The updated Toyota Camry doesn't seem easy either. With the stretched smile of the narrow radiator grille and the wide mouth of the front bumper air intake, the appearance of the sedan has become more interesting and visually more expensive. Camry, of course, is not a beauty, but the car is not without ambition - deliberately large and in places awkward sedan, it seems, just screams about its high position. Although the interior with an abundance of leather and wood seems expensive only at first glance. In fact, everything is simpler: plastic wood-like lining looks naive, leather upholstery is simple, and hands now and then stumble upon simple plastic parts. However, everything was done soundly, albeit without any trick. Optitronic devices are clear and understandable, on the steering wheel there is an arsenal of buttons for controlling on-board electronics, and on the tunnel there is a tray for wireless charging of gadgets - an almost ingenious thing, which, alas, has been implemented so far only in a dozen expensive smartphones.

The interior of the Passat is gorgeous even without all the luxury tinsel. It is drawn so neatly and precisely that for the first time it seems like it was in one of the new Audi models. Although there are actually more elements from the younger Golf. And no flirting with pseudo-wood: lacquered panels, strict chrome and aluminum, well-made leather. The top of the panel is skillfully styled as ventilation deflectors, the console is slightly turned towards the driver with a slight hint, and the embossed steering wheel is slightly truncated in a sporty way at the bottom. It is clear that in simple versions, traditional scales with a small screen in the middle are installed, but such devices look very good too.

Both the basic Passat seats and the more expensive ones with a dozen electric drives grip the riders equally well and are easily adjusted to almost any figure. And on the back couch you don't have to think about your own dimensions at all. Passengers taller than 180 cm in the rear seats of the Passat do not have to bend their heads at all. There is also an indecent amount of knee room - in terms of the amount of space between the rows, the Passat will lose only to the Skoda Superb liftback with its long base.

There may not be more space in the second row of the Camry, but there is also a lot of it, and for representative purposes this is a definite plus. In addition, the top version of the Camry is equipped with separate back seats with electrically adjustable backrests and a separate climate control panel, which is a rarity even in the premium segment. The front seats are not at all the amorphous sofas that were known before. Perforated leather hides precise electric drives and adequate waist support. But the sportiness in the seats is zero - the position obliges to have wide-spaced and unobtrusive lateral support rollers. The slender driver is too spacious here, the fuller one is just right. Ergonomics are appropriate: soft padded seats, relaxed seating position, large steering wheel.

An interesting detail: the Japanese sedan in the version with separate rear seats has a less capacious trunk, and the seats themselves do not fold - only a modest hatch for long vehicles is at the owner's disposal. The simpler versions offer a standard set of transformations - the back of the rear sofa can be reclined in parts into the salon. The Camry's wide luggage compartment is simple, but spacious. Roof rack Passat It's a pity to load, like an expensive wardrobe with good finishes, convenient hooks and compartments for small things, where you don't want to put your street shoes at all. Here, the lid also rises by itself, you just have to wave your foot under rear bumper... Of course, for a surcharge.

The character of the 1.8-liter Volkswagen turbo engine is well-known, and in the modern 180-horsepower version it is even more incendiary. With such a large torque shelf, it can be used for lazy relaxed driving too, but this style is not for the Passat owner. Juicy acceleration in each gear, instant DSG shifts - for intense acceleration, you don't even have to twist the engine to the red zone. It is clear that at low revs, when the turbine barely moves, the engine is weak, but the smart DSG gearbox does not allow the turbo engine to work in such modes. Unless, with a quiet ride, she prefers higher gears too much.

The Camry does not have incendiary turbo engines, but in the case of a 2.5-liter aspirated engine, this is neither good nor bad: the average engine in the lineup spins up smoothly and confidently, delighting with a decent supply of traction at almost any speed. One has only to press down the gas, as the sedan gratefully responds with strong acceleration. The elasticity of this engine does not occupy. The Camry six-speed automatic transmission does not have an honest manual mode (the lever can only limit the gear range), but it is not required. Camry 2.5 fits into city traffic without annoying box lags, and this is quite enough for a confident drive. The ragged rhythm is not for her - the “automatic” is tuned for comfort and switches calmly and accurately.

From generation to generation, the Camry has become more responsive, and after the last update, the suspension seems almost European elastic. But the car did not become a driver car. The Camry chassis imperceptibly sorts out road trifles, but the suspension lets more defects into the cabin. On a straight line, the sedan is very stable and predictable, but there is no excitement in the corners. Just overspeed, and the car slides safely out of the corner. And at the same time, the steering wheel is, one might say, empty.

The Passat is a different matter: precise, fast and responsive, it reacts almost instantly to the driver's actions, giving a feeling of complete control over the car. And all this despite the fact that the eighth generation sedan has become even more comfortable than the Camry. He walks along the highway, gently swaying and carefully filtering all road ripples. Irregularities are collected, but comfortable. And in turns it gives the steering wheel a correct and understandable effort, with light rolls prescribing turns, so much so that you want to do it again and again. Reference handling without any adjustments for comfort.

An even more refined eighth Passat gropingly enters the market, where the updated Camry sits as a strong owner and does not see a competitor at close range. Camry has been the leader in its segment since 2002, and the model recently survived from the market of even the nearest competitor Nissan Teana. In business, as it often happens, the economy again intervened - Toyota's simple and understandable pricing policy helped Camry to become the undisputed leader of the segment.

The most democratic Camry in the "Standard" version with a 2.0-liter engine costs 1,284,000 rubles, but it makes sense to focus on the "Standard Plus" version with an LCD display of the media system and a price of 1,339,000 rubles. The less powerful 122-horsepower Passat Trendline with manual gearbox costs exactly the same - the input version, the equipment of which looks quite a compromise. DSG box already equipped with a Passat with a 150-horsepower engine in the Comfortline version, and this is at least 1,579,000 rubles. against 1,543,000 rubles. for the 181-horsepower Camry 2.5 in the advanced Elegance Plus package. Prices for a comparable in power Passat 1.8 just start at 1,779,000 rubles, for which you can already take a Camry with a 3.5 V6 engine in a fairly packaged configuration.

At the same time, it cannot be said that the base Passat Comfortline is empty: there is a dual-zone climate control, heating windshield, tire pressure monitoring system and LED headlights. But the test sedan, equipped with adaptive headlights, a dashboard display, all-round cameras, a navigator and an electric trunk drive, is already worth almost indecent 2.4 million rubles. Passat can be customized for yourself subtly and for a long time. But a wide choice, as you know, often only gets in the way. The Japanese approach with fixed configurations is not to everyone's liking, but the law of large numbers in a crisis works especially clearly: the one who has fewer numbers in the price lists turns out to be more successful. That is why Russians will continue to dream of Volkswagen Passat counting bills in Toyota showrooms.

Exterior

The new Passat has remained recognizable, although the manufacturers have introduced new lines to the design. It was assembled on the same platform as the Passat B7. A significant difference in height - the roof of the new generation of sedans has become lower.

Thinking over the body, the engineers wanted to create a more sporty style. The lines have become sharper, and the "muzzle" more aggressive. A chrome-plated horizontal trim shines at the front, which runs along the false grille and is continued in the head optics.

By the way, the headlights of the new VW are LED. Fully LED optics including turn signals are available for an additional fee.

In general, the car looks more modern, but German conservatism inevitably catches the eye. Volkswagen is extremely reluctant to make changes to its models, so there is no need to wait for cardinal innovations.

The new model is very similar to the Volkswagen Passat B7. Despite this, the car looks simple, tasteful and with a note of sporty enthusiasm.

Separately, I would like to note the Volkswagen Passat SS, which was created specifically for the North American market. It was developed on the basis of the standard Passat, but became lower, wider and longer than its brother.

This appearance made the car more aggressive, but it negatively affected the practicality of the model. However, it is worth mentioning that the car achieved its goal - the Passat began to be successfully sold in America.

The restyling of the Toyota Camry was also received positively. Compared to Camry V40 new model became sharper and more defiant. Although this can not be said at all in terms of handling.

On the front bumper there is a huge air intake that instills fear in drivers who barely noticed the car in the rear-view mirror.

But unlike the Passat, the new Camry looks simpler. Although the German is conservative, even he could not surpass Toyota in terms of design restraint. A minimum of lines and stampings on body parts. All charisma is concentrated exclusively in the front. The rest of the Toyota body is very simple and minimalistic. However, this does not prevent the updated sedan from looking more attractive.

And although both cars are no longer young - the models were released in 2015 - their appearance can and continues to compete with the already new sedans in their class. This is evidenced by the number of sales.

Interior

Toyota Camry and Volkswagen Passat are very similar in their purpose, but differ in its implementation. Both cars aimed to create a comfortable, presentable, but not pretentious, premium interior.

Sitting in the new Passat B8, you immediately realize 2 important things. First: VAG's conservatism can be traced even inside.

The manufacturer practically did not change anything and used the proven layout of the controls, slightly improving them. And secondly: Volkswagen Passat B8 is no longer Skoda, but not yet Audi! And this thought will help you when answering the question, is it worth buying this model.

Pride new Volkswagen Passat is a huge 12-inch display in place on-board computer... All data on speed, engine speed, temperature, fuel consumption and other indicators are now on the display, which changes its design and functionality at your request.

If you wish, you can even display the navigation map on the on-board computer screen, although the monitor on the central panel is intended for this. Although this option is very convenient and interesting, it can be purchased only in the maximum configuration.

In Toyota Camry, everything is simple, but ergonomic and functional. If we compare with the opponent, the quality of finishing materials "sags" a little. In the interior, there was a cutting eye plastic made under a tree.

However, the Camry also has its advantages. On the armrest of the second row, there are JBL multimedia control buttons, which the competitor does not have.

There is more space in the back row inside the Camry. This is especially true for the space above your head.

In the German, by lowering the roof level, tall passengers will have to comb their hair along the ceiling. And if you sit in the back row in the Passat SS, then you risk not standing up straight at all.

The ergonomics and seating comfort in both cars are equally good. But in terms of the trunk, Toyota is seriously losing: 506 liters. useful volume against 586 liters. from VW.

In addition, the German has an electric boot with a virtual pedal under the bumper. Both have a full-size wheel and a tool box under the floor.

Controllability

The 2017 Camry is renowned for its softness. Smooth and energy-intensive suspension successfully “swallows” any irregularities. But in comparison with the opponent, the Japanese lacks steering clarity. The reaction to the driver's movements is delayed, so over long distances you will get tired, constantly returning the car to the desired trajectory. The car is certainly comfortable, but slow in feedback. You will not be able to experience thrills on it.

Despite its sporty look, the 2015 Volkswagen Passat also doesn't sparkle with drive. The car is quite calm and does not differ in explosive dynamics. But in the stream, you definitely will not lag behind. The steering wheel of the German is sharper and sharper. It is not the best in the class, but in comparison with Toyota it is more responsive.

The Passat SS can boast of greater sharpness of control. There are no special technical innovations that would distinguish it from the standard Passat, but due to the lower roof and center of gravity, as well as the wheels on low-profile rubber, the steering wheel in the car is clearer.

One of the most controversial points in VAG-group cars is the box. DSG transmission which is also installed on the 2018 models. Volkswagen offers customers 4 types of engines and 3 types of gearboxes - 6MKPP, 6DSG and 7DSG.

The new Passat can be purchased with the following engine types:

  1. 1.4 l. (125 hp);
  2. 1.4 l. (150 hp);
  3. 1.8 l. (180 hp);
  4. 2.0 l. TDI (150 hp).

The Toyota Camry can be ordered with 2.0 liter, 2.5 liter and 3.5 liter engines. Complete with 3.5 liter V6 engine. will cost you 2 million rubles. Maximum equipment for the Passat Highline with diesel engine will cost about 1,990 thousand rubles.

If we take similar configurations of both models, their average price tag will be approximately the same. Therefore, the cost will not significantly affect the choice of the buyer. What remains is the purpose and the matter of taste.

VW is more conservative, but in terms of interior design, it looks more attractive and technologically advanced than its Japanese competitor. As for the driving style, it is more comfortable to sit in the back seat in the Camry, and in the front seat in the Passat. The cost of maintenance is about the same, since at Toyota the replacement of some units, although it costs less, is required more often according to the regulations. Reliability remains! There are no equals to Toyota in this parameter yet. And the availability of used spare parts for secondary market make Camry repairs more affordable. From 2015 to 2017, sales of the Japanese sedan in Russia accounted for almost half of the entire business segment. It turns out that there is Toyota and everyone else. Moreover, none of its buyers are embarrassed that as many as three generations of the model - XV30, XV40 and XV50 - have shared one platform for seventeen years.

Therefore, the "move" to the new global architecture of TNGA can be considered a revolutionary event. Not only has the car's length and wheelbase increased by 35 and 50 mm, respectively, it has never looked so bright, if not bold, before. But now it is extremely difficult not to notice it, while the Passat with its smooth-shaven, impassive face practically does not stand out in the car mass.

Toyota Сamry is slightly squat and wider than the German sedan. LED lights are available for both

What the new "Japanese woman" carefully inherited from its predecessor is a wide variety of trim levels. There are already seven of them at the start of sales. Moreover, even the basic version of the model for 1,399,000 rubles is equipped with automatic transmission, separate climate control and alloy wheels, and starting from the version "Elegance Safety" from 1 818 000 rubles - a complete package of systems active safety including adaptive cruise control.

Three supercharged engines are available to buyers, as before. The most powerful 3.5-liter V6 and 8-speed automatic transmission are all new. But they are put only the most expensive configurations"Lux" and "Executive". The rest are armed with 6-band gearboxes known from the previous generation car and in-line "fours" with a working volume of 2 and 2.5 liters. The latter, due to its evidently greater popularity, became our choice for this comparative test.

DAMPING ON ASSETS

Ford is the only one of the trinity to provide a choice of chassis settings through electronically controlled shock absorbers. In the city "Mondeo" softly spreads in "comfort", not noticing neither small nor large irregularities. With an increase in speed, it begins to sway strongly, on short waves the wheels practically break away from the asphalt. There is a feeling of driving not on a sedan, but on a heavy pickup truck with a spring suspension - here both tremors and vibrations. Switching to "normal" mode is a completely different matter. The suspension is gathering, the storm is abating. True, now all the road "dirt" comes to the steering wheel, and on strong potholes the suspension works noisily.

Let's try "sport"? Not on winter tracks near Moscow! It looks like cars with cold oil shock absorbers drive in 35-degree frost. It was as if all the rubber joints had been removed from the suspension. Moreover, the rolling noise of the tires also increases. So is it worth overpaying for this option? In our opinion, it is still worth it: it gives a certain degree of freedom.

I remember that the previous generation Camry left an impression of being soothingly soft. In suspension new car stiffer springs and shock absorbers with progressive compression and rebound characteristics. And what? From now on, Toyota does not hover over the road, like on an air cushion. Yes, it is still more comfortable than a Ford with its "three-stage" suspension and still perfectly smooths out minor irregularities. But if you hit something bigger, feel a short jolt with your whole body. Well, the "shock resistance" is still at its best: for several hundred kilometers, we have never brought the suspension to a breakdown. Noise isolation is just great! Additional mats have appeared in the wheel arches, trunk and even sills, so from time to time you hear only a slight rustle of "sandblasting".

Volkswagen resembles a manager who first came to winter Moscow from somewhere from Bavaria: boots with thin soles sink in a slush, the wind ruffles the floors of a demi-season coat ... It freezes, but does not admit it. "Passat" fearlessly shines cold xenon on the sand-stained lines and rushes towards adventure. Alas, his suspension was drawn with the expectation of a different asphalt. Therefore, we flinched several times, stating the breakdown. However, there is a cure for this, and it is definitely not worth saving on it - order a car with a package for bad roads... But even on the road, which my colleague calls nothing other than "dribbling", "Passat" convinces by the complete absence of squeaks in the cabin.

FLOW OF FUNDS

The Ford should be boldly tucked into a corner, but only if the suspension is in sport mode. The sedan is certainly not a sports car, but you feel quite confident thanks to the responsive steering wheel. The stabilization system is also insured, which can be turned off ... at the nearest shop. Because the computer allows you to do this only in statics. The same hassle with traction control: stuck in the snow, do you want to add gas? - you are welcome to look through the menu and put a tick, where it should be. Where the automotive world is heading!

The turbo engine "Mondeo" is excellent in elasticity: it has the greatest torque among its rivals - 300 Nm, the "shelf" of which extends from 1750 to 4500 rpm. But if you're racing at full speed, there will soon be complaints about the PowerShift dual-clutch transmission. Its "brains" are tuned to efficiency, so the box tends to go to an increased one at the earliest opportunity. But when you want to accelerate sharply, the unit does not have time to quickly jump down. We also didn't like the brakes - a short and stale pedal gives rise to uncertainty, especially in the city, where accuracy is so important.

To compensate for the denser Toyota suspension, we expected more gambling handling. Alas, the Camry is still bland to the driver. A sedan with a pronounced understeer is prone to roll.

The place of the former hydraulic booster was taken by an electric unit, and the connection between the driver and the car was lost, forgive the pun, irrevocably. The steering wheel is overly light even at solid speeds and does not give the driver enough information about the position of the wheels. One hope for the vestibular apparatus. The VSC stability system is still non-deactivable, which is not bad considering the tendency to skid. To be fair, I will note: she is not set up as uncompromisingly as before.

According to the passport "Toyota" is inferior to "Ford" and "Volkswagen" 19 and 29 forces, respectively. But compared to its predecessor, the 2.5-liter engine is just a song! "Japanese" is noticeably faster in acceleration, however, in terms of elasticity, it cannot compete with turbo engines. The six-speed automatic is unhurried in kickdown, but soft on normal gear changes. In manual mode, you can play with the lever, but if the tachometer needle reaches the limiter, the overdrive will turn on without asking. Sport mode primitively disables two upshifts. It's simple ... But it's logical.

"Passat" shoots faster than opponents as expected - it is 87 kg (according to our measurements) lighter than the "Ford", although heavier than the less powerful "Toyota" by 75 kg. In combination with a 2-liter turbo engine, a 6-speed automatic with two clutches DSG, therefore, a duel with "Ford" suggests itself. The Volkswagen unit also tends to run into higher gears, but it comes back down much more readily than PowerShift. I did not like the sharp reaction to the gas: it was not always possible to move smoothly. But worse, when starting slowly, there are unpleasant vibrations, like on a car with a burnt clutch. By the way, when driving onto a low curb in vnatyag, I smelled a characteristic smell ... Did you really burn the clutch on the machine? It turns out that it happens.

But for the way the "German" drives, he can be forgiven for everything! Absolute transparency on the steering wheel, pleasant increase in cornering effort, instant response to correction allow you to rush (on the ice!) Confidently, as if it were May. The stabilization system intervenes just at the moment when you are waiting for her help, and works most efficiently and at the same time delicately. The brakes are filigree.
